The Importance of Placeholders in Development
In the grand scheme of software and web development, the role of placeholders, such as our friend "psepsennase seseaudiose selolsese," is more significant than one might initially think. Placeholders serve several crucial functions that contribute to a smoother and more efficient development process. One of the primary benefits of using placeholders is that they allow developers to focus on the structure and layout of a project without being bogged down by the details of the actual content. This is especially important in the early stages of development when the content may still be in flux. By using placeholder text or images, developers can create a visual representation of the final product and get a better sense of how everything will fit together. This allows them to make adjustments and refinements to the design before committing to the actual content. Another important function of placeholders is that they help to ensure consistency across different parts of a project. By using a standard set of placeholders, developers can maintain a uniform look and feel throughout the entire application or website. This is particularly important for large projects with multiple developers working on different components. Placeholders also play a crucial role in testing and debugging. By using placeholder data, developers can simulate real-world scenarios and test the functionality of their code without risking any damage to actual data. This allows them to identify and fix bugs early in the development process, saving time and resources in the long run. Furthermore, placeholders can be used to demonstrate the functionality of a project to stakeholders or clients. By using placeholder data to create a working prototype, developers can give stakeholders a clear idea of how the final product will look and function. This can help to build consensus and ensure that everyone is on the same page before development begins.
